Runway Tips
   Study the Field
In discussing photographing fashion shows with Ben, we took a look at the photographs of past runway fashion shows to consider what framing/composition ideas would work for the shoot. New York Fashion has a great section of runway images to study: notice the amount of room left below shoes and above the models heads in the full length photographs, and notice the relationship of model to background.
 
Position is Key
Expect a crowd fighting over the best positions to photograph from, and realize that you'll need to get there early and also have the proper permissions from the organizers. (At the big events, of course, there is a process requiring a press pass and often you'll need to request one months ahead.) If you get a great spot, do your best to keep it and maintain enough room to do your work. Before throwing any elbows or harsh words at the other photographers, though, remember you may see the same group at the next event. Probably better to make some new friends. If you can get access, also consider that "behind the scenes" photographs might also be useful. Consider also hanging out after the fashion show and handing out some of your business cards — you might make great contacts with hair and makeup people, and maybe the models as well. It's a great opportunity for networking.  
Fashion Tips
Spend money on great shoes because they can make or break an outfit. You can even wear them with jeans    and look fabulous!
 
Buy items that fit your lifestyle. If you know you are going to live in your jeans then it is ok to spend $150 a pair especially if you had to try on dozens to find the right fit. Buy clothes to suit your lifestyle.
 
Spend money on staples on shoes, bags, a cashmere sweater, a black pair of pants and skimp on belts, socks, trendy tops, scarves, hats and sunglasses.
 
Posing Tips
Live show models, promo models, photographic models, and runway models all rely on professional model poses to succeed. 
 
Whether you aspire to appear in print magazines or fashion shows and Hollywood movies; if you want to be a model, pay special attention to this insider guide to modeling poses.
 
Breathe
Although sometimes concentration enhances a good photograph, obvious concentration can distract and often ruin a good photograph as well.   Do not hold your breath for a modeling pose; always remember to breathe and appear at ease.
